This much improved detached home on Minton Road offers generous family accommodation across two levels, with four main bedrooms plus a fifth room accessed via bedroom four. The property has been newly renovated, benefits from double glazing, gas central heating and installed solar panels purchased outright, helping to reduce running costs. The sizeable 21ft through lounge/dining room opens to a feature balcony with pleasant outlooks, and the well-maintained rear garden provides a private outdoor space for children and entertaining.
Practical features include off-street parking with a driveway and carport, a re-fitted kitchen with integrated oven and hob, and a lower-ground level that provides flexible living or storage space. The property is positioned in a cul-de-sac with straightforward access to Harborne town centre, local shops, and good schools, making it suitable for families seeking space close to amenities and commuting routes into Birmingham.
Buyers should note some material considerations: there is a single family bathroom serving four bedrooms, bedroom five is only accessible through bedroom four which may limit privacy, and the local area records above-average crime and very high deprivation indicators. There is a medium flood risk for the location — prospective buyers should obtain specific flood and insurance advice.
Overall this freehold detached house presents a ready-to-move-in family home with modern comforts and scope for reconfiguring internal layout if a separate fifth bedroom or additional bathroom is required. It will appeal to families wanting space, a good garden and solar-equipped running-cost savings, while investors may value its rental potential in a popular suburb close to Harborne.
